Our First Time at the Great Yorkshire Show – And What a Show It Was!
In July 2024, we had the pleasure of exhibiting at our very first Great Yorkshire Show – and what an incredible experience it was! From the moment the gates opened on 9th July through to the final day on the 12th, we were blown away by the sheer scale of the event, the warm welcome from visitors, and the buzz that filled the showground every single day.
As one of the UK’s biggest agricultural trade shows, now in its impressive 165th year, the Great Yorkshire Show is a true celebration of rural life. It brings together thousands of people from across the country – farmers, growers, makers, and innovators – all united by a shared passion for the land and the communities that thrive on it.
We were thrilled to be part of that mix, showcasing a small but mighty selection of our container range, a 20ft ‘one trip’ container, brand new and ready for action, an 8ft new build container, ideal for tighter spaces and a 6ft new build container, compact and versatile
It was fantastic to see how much interest there was in our containers, especially from those in the farming community looking for secure, practical solutions for everything from equipment storage to feed sheds and mobile workshops. The versatility of containers really came into its own, with conversations covering an impressive range of uses!
